Job description

Job purpose:

The Assistant Vice President (AVP) in the CoC GIF division will undertake transaction analysis, assist with structuring the transaction and supporting the due diligence and documentation process for the CoC GIF deal team.

In the deal team, the AVP supports and/or coordinates the necessary steps in the loan process and accompanies the financing until the final disbursement. The AVP works transactionally and, as part of the role responsibilities, has a high interface function to internal and external (lawyers, advisors, agency and clients) project participants.

In addition to a focus on new business, the AVP works on the analysis and ongoing support (including consent and waiver requests) of existing transactions and simple restructurings.

Key activities:

  1. Support Head of Project Finance APAC and wider CoC GIF team in originating, structuring, arranging, negotiating, syndicating (if required), documenting and closing of Project Finance transactions
  2. Assist with deal screening, confidentiality agreements, Expressions of Interest, Request for Proposal, Letters of Interest/Support and similar early-stage transaction activities
  3. Coordination and follow-up of the necessary work steps in the deal team with the involvement of the project participants (including internal product specialists and external advisors)
  4. Analysis of the submitted documents for each transaction and assistance with development of a transaction summary and structuring memo
  5. Filling and maintenance of the cash flow tool, development of a rating proposal in the rating tool Specialised Finance as well as assisting with the evaluation of the risk-return profile
  6. Assist with the preparation of all internal processes, documents and applications to support the credit approval process
  7. Assist with analysis and negotiation of the documentation from the offer phase to the final loan documentation (incl. participation in negotiations with customers and external lawyers)
  8. After signing, support of the disbursement phase with the involvement of the project participants
  9. In the existing business, processing of the annual renewal as well as ongoing support of the investment and its restructuring
  10. Keep abreast of market knowledge and industry developments to support the business
  11. Maintain good relationships with both external and internal stakeholders

Formal education:

University degree/diploma/Master preferably in banking, finance, economics, business administration, law, or related studies.

Specialist knowledge (work experience, further qualification):

5+ years of professional experience in: (1) the field of project finance banking with a focus on the renewable energy sector or (2) other strongly connected relevant banking experience if candidate demonstrates clear ability to adapt quickly to the requirements of the role

Description of specifications with regards to work profiles:

  1. Fluent in English (spoken and written), German language skills highly advantageous and other language capabilities well-regarded
  2. Largely independent and self-reliant processing of topics in the area of responsibility with a strong solution orientation in project financing with high complexity
  3. Knowledge of the renewables and green infrastructure sectors, or ability to clearly demonstrate quick learning of the relevant sectors
  4. Knowledge in the structuring of renewables project financing, or ability to clearly demonstrate quick learning of the relevant skills
  5. Experience with dealing with typical external counterparties expected on Project Finance transactions, such as client teams (treasury, finance, technical), external legal advisers and consultants and other banks or lending institutions (e.g. ECAs, DFIs)
  6. Participation in advisory mandates for renewables transactions advantageous
  7. Strong team and customer orientation, commitment, initiative, flexibility and high level of commitment
  8. Strong analytical, modelling and numerical skills (ideally a good understanding of general accounting standards and financial analysis fundamentals such as calculating financial ratios)
  9. Strong attention to detail, problem solving, analytical and communication skills
  10. Good knowledge of Excel, PowerPoint and Word
